Emotions in mediation: the key to making smart choices

In CRCICA’s monthly mediation breakfast seminar, Dr. Alexander shed the light on emotions in mediation as a fundamental factor in making decisions. It was emphasized that the recognition of one’s and others’ emotions in mediation is fundamental to manage and best deal with them and, hence, make smart decisions.

Attendees, drawn from the legal and engineering field, recognized the need to give appropriate attention and deal properly with emotions in mediation as a tool to reaching successful settlement.
